I met a really sharp young man today. I was up at Davidson College practicing some moves on my motorcycle, ( I’m sure the wrong way) and they are simple moves. I do the S curves and figure eights on the empty parking spots. I practice stopping fast. The hardest thing I do is stand up on the pegs and stay mobile slowly. That trick took many years of knee(s) therapy.
Out of the corner of my eye I spy a NOVA! The Nova was all by herself. I circled her a few times. Then Security showed up and asked me if I wanted him to move it. Jonathan from Security happened to own the car! I said no, but would love to photograph the car. Jonathan is 29 years old and has been across the country four times. He served our country. He has a classic car collection I hope to get to shoot sometime .
He cranked her up and told me her name but I forgot. Her name starts with an R like all his red cars!
